Transaction 70eb4ec2a530ddc9a3de3544e9b75ccd153302826998c0ac3d12c7883584dc87

50 Input
2 Outputs
  • 70eb4ec2a530ddc9a3de3544e9b75ccd153302826998c0ac3d12c7883584dc87:0
  • value  946206096
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 70eb4ec2a530ddc9a3de3544e9b75ccd153302826998c0ac3d12c7883584dc87:1
  • value  514703
    address  3Dsa16HwvHhGWDFXw6iBU451k6M8ZnGBUt